Author:  HRC [ Fri May 08, 2009 5:00 pm ]
Post subject:  Re: 2009 Le Mans Series Discussion

No, I'll explain again. Last year I bought a ticket with paddock access, instead of the general admission. You can then enter the paddock via the tunnel underneath the circuit. But when the pitwalk started they didn't let us in because apparently you needed some special pass (to me it sounded a lot like the whole paddock club F1 thing). If the drivers autograph session is at the back of the pit you shouldn't have a problem, if its in the pit itself then you won't get in, at least not with a paddock pass.

My problem was that I saw a lot of people in the paddock who just had general admission. So apparently security wasn't that good and I felt ripped off because I payed 15 Euro's more. Of course all of this is based on 2008 and knowing Spa they could have easily changed it all this year.

I still remember vividly the first time I went in 2005. You just payed 20 Euro's and then you could stand wherever you wanted. Whether that was in the woods at Blanchimont or in the middle of the Pescarolo, watching a pitstop. There were only two places where you couldn't walk, on the track and in the Oreca Audi pit.

Author:  HRC [ Fri May 08, 2009 11:39 pm ]
Post subject:  Re: 2009 Le Mans Series Discussion

Don't forget that the session was interrupted by rain and that it never really dried out. Anyway, Peugeot is treating Spa like a test session for Le Mans. At Sebring one of their cars had an airco failure during the race. With the IMSA rules that wasn't a problem, they could have continued and challenged for the win. But Peugeot decided to bring the car in and work on the problem because the ACO rules say they have to cool the temperature in the cockpit. I don't think they're here to sandbag or to show off, they just want the exercise and make sure they're ready for the big one. Apparently the latest changes were done after Sebring and the car is now finished and ready for Le Mans, all they're working on now is getting the team to do their work more efficient.
